While the overall risk remains low, the European Medicines Agency reported in 2025 that non-arteritic anterior ischemic optic neuropathy (NAION), a condition that can cause blindness, is a "very rare" side effect of semaglutide medicines, including Ozempic. This has prompted crucial questions about how Ozempic and other GLP-1 agonists may impact vision, especially for those with underlying health issues.
